Output 758f093b58df4135e623e48d489fdc327eee7c0672d5299bac2831879949e99a:2

value
2674000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190143198a50621eecbf1562a068cdcda8b2bb49 OP_EQUAL
address
33yEL2q563c5BdHKho94ELPq8TicvAVABq
transaction
758f093b58df4135e623e48d489fdc327eee7c0672d5299bac2831879949e99a
spent
true